Major Fire Breaks Out at Furniture Manufacturing Unit in Hyderabad’s Gudimalkapur

Hyderabad: A major fire broke out at a furniture manufacturing unit near Vintage Function Hall in Gudimalkapur on Monday midnight, triggering panic in the area.
The flames quickly spread to two adjacent furniture workshops, causing significant damage to combustible materials stored inside the premises.
On receiving information, the Gudimalkapur police and fire department personnel rushed to the spot and took up firefighting operations with four fire engines.
After several hours of efforts which went up to Tuesday early hours, the blaze was brought under control, preventing it from spreading further to nearby structures.
The police and emergency teams secured the area and assisted in the rescue and firefighting operations.
Kulsumpura ACP Tirupathi visited the spot and supervised the relief measures. The cause of the fire is yet to be ascertained, and an inquiry is on.
